Course Description
The downhill Mississauga Marathon course loses approximately 250 feet from start to finish. There are some small hills around 10km and 30km. This downhill and flat course, coupled with relatively good temperatures on a typical race day, can lead to PRs and BQs for many runners. If the weather is cooler than normal and the humidity is low, the Mississauga Marathon can be one of the fastest courses in Canada and the United States.

The course starts at Mercer St. & Princess Royal Dr at Square One and makes its way west across the Credit River to Mississauga Road and then travels south for a stretch past the University of Toronto's Mississauga Campus, Mississaugua Golf and Country Club, and continues through residential neighborhoods, before winding along Lake Ontario Waterfront Trail, and finishing on the edge of Lake Ontario at Lakefront Promenade Park.

Mississauga Marathon Rankings, Course Speed & Boston Qualifier Statistics

The Mississauga Marathon was the 11th largest marathon in Canada in 2025 based on the number of finishers. In 2024, it ranked as the 14th largest marathon in Canada.

In 2026, 10.7% of Mississauga Marathon finishers have achieved Boston Marathon qualifying times. In 2025, 10% of finishers qualified for the Boston Marathon.

Based on its percentage of Boston Qualifiers (BQs), the Mississauga Marathon ranked 11th among marathons in Canada in 2025 and currently ranks 5th so far in 2026. In Ontario, it ranked 6th in 2025 and 4th so far in 2026. These rankings provide a useful benchmark for comparing the Mississauga Marathon with other Boston Marathon qualifying races.


The Mississauga Marathon has a Course Score of 99.31, ranking it as the 11th fastest marathon course in Canada and the 7th fastest marathon course in Ontario.

Typical race-time temperature and humidity levels are within the ideal range for optimal marathon performance. Combined with the course profile, this gives the Mississauga Marathon a PR Score of 99.31. The PR Score ranks the Mississauga Marathon as the 11th best marathon in Canada for running a Personal Record (PR) and the 7th best marathon for a PR in Ontario.

Great Race

Full Review:

I really enjoyed this race. It is well organized and has plenty of aid stations. It is well marked and not crowded at all for the full marathon if you prefer running in a smeller running field. There is some tricky hills that slowed me down in the last ten miles, makes me want to come back again next year and redeem myself.

Race Tips:

Don't get too carried away on the downhills in the beginning start conservatively and be prepared for the up hills during the last 15k

Travel/Logistics Tips:

If you're able to, stay in downtown Mississauga so you can walk to the start line

Full Review:

Fantastic course, very scenic, not too crowded, well organized. Totally enjoyable!

Race Tips:

The first 8 miles are noticeably downhill, whereas around mile 18 or 19 it feels like the inclines are bigger than they are, so pace yourself!

Travel/Logistics Tips:

Taxis can cost you an arm and a leg if you don't know where to stay. I would recommend staying by the Square One Mall, which is the start line. There are also shuttles from the finish line back to Square One. This will save you a lot of $!
